Missing Number 1..N

Missing Number 1..N

Medium PHP PHP Arrays 25 views
Explanation Complexity

Problem Statement

You get n-1 numbers from 1..n. Find the missing number.

Input Format

Line1 n. Line2 n-1 integers.

Output Format

One integer missing.

Example

5
1 2 4 5
3

Constraints

n

Input / Output Format

Input Format
Line1 n. Line2 n-1 integers.
Output Format
One integer missing.
Constraints
n

Examples

Input:
5 1 2 4 5
Output:
3

Example Solution (Public)

PHP
<?php
$inputText=trim(stream_get_contents(STDIN));
if($inputText==='') exit;
$tokens=preg_split('/\\s+/', $inputText);
$i=0; $n=intval($tokens[$i++] ?? 0);
$sum=intdiv($n*($n+1),2);
for($k=0;$k<$n-1;$k++) $sum -= intval($tokens[$i++] ?? 0);
echo $sum;
?>

Official Solution Code

<?php
$inputText=trim(stream_get_contents(STDIN));
if($inputText==='') exit;
$tokens=preg_split('/\\s+/', $inputText);
$i=0; $n=intval($tokens[$i++] ?? 0);
$sum=intdiv($n*($n+1),2);
for($k=0;$k<$n-1;$k++) $sum -= intval($tokens[$i++] ?? 0);
echo $sum;
?>
Please login to submit solutions.
Editor
Output

                                        
Please login to submit solutions.